Can I mine Bitcoin?
Are you wondering if it's possible to mine Bitcoin? The answer is yes, but it's not as straightforward as it once was. Mining Bitcoin requires specialized hardware, significant computing power, and a deep understanding of blockchain technology. Additionally, the mining difficulty has increased significantly over time, making it increasingly difficult for individual miners to profitably mine Bitcoin. However, if you're still interested in mining Bitcoin, there are several options available, such as joining a mining pool or investing in cloud mining services. Keep in mind that the profitability of mining Bitcoin can vary greatly depending on factors such as the cost of electricity, the efficiency of your mining hardware, and the current price of Bitcoin.
